Dulacha G. Barako is a scholar working on Accounting, Strategy and Management and Sociology and Political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Dulacha G. Barako has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 1.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Accounting, 6 papers in Strategy and Management and 5 papers in Sociology and Political Science. Recurrent topics in Dulacha G. Barako's work include Corporate Finance and Governance (7 papers), Auditing, Earnings Management, Governance (4 papers) and Financial Reporting and Valuation Research (3 papers). Dulacha G. Barako is often cited by papers focused on Corporate Finance and Governance (7 papers), Auditing, Earnings Management, Governance (4 papers) and Financial Reporting and Valuation Research (3 papers). Dulacha G. Barako collaborates with scholars based in Australia, Kenya and Switzerland. Dulacha G. Barako's co-authors include Phil Hancock, H.Y. Izan, Alistair Brown, Greg Tower, Poh‐Ling Ho, Rusmin Rusmin, David Mathuva, Ross Taplin, Philip Hancock and Alexander Kostyuk and has published in prestigious journals such as Corporate Governance An International Review, Journal of Small Business and Enterprise Development and Journal of Management & Governance.
